VUB Doctoral Scholarship in Nuclear Safety and Radiation Protection in Belgium, 2018

The VUB AVN is calling applications for doctoral (PhD) scholarship in nuclear safety and radiation protection to study in Belgium. This scholarship is available to students from EU or EEA or Switzerland.

The VUB AVN Fund aims to finance a four-year doctoral scholarship within the nuclear safety and radiation protection research domain. A doctoral scholarship will be funded every four years.

Scholarship Description: 

  • Applications Deadline: July 15, 2018
  • Course Level: Scholarship is available to pursue Doctoral (PhD) programme.
  • Study Subject: Scholarship is awarded in the field of nuclear safety and radiation protection.
  • Scholarship Award: Staff costs PhD student + 10% operational allowance.
  • Nationality: Available to students from EU or of the EEA or Switzerland.
  • Number of Scholarships: Numbers not given
  • Scholarship can be taken in Belgium

Eligibility for the Scholarship: 

Eligible Countries: This scholarship is available to students from EU or of the EEA or Switzerland.

Entrance Requirements: Applicants must meet the following criteria:

• The supervisor is at least 10% ZAP member of one of the VUB faculties.
• The doctoral student has a master’s degree awarded in one of the countries of the EU or of the EEA or Switzerland.• The doctoral student obtained this diploma with at least the mention “distinction” (cum laude).
• The supervisor and the doctoral student agree with the obligations annually and scientifically financial report and submit it to the steering committee of the VUB AVN Fund and the VUB AVN. Fund to mention in any scientific publication or communication related to its research project.
• The promoter and doctoral student act in accordance with the applicable VUB regulations.

Application Procedure: 

How to Apply: Application and selection procedure

  • The supervisor must work separately or in collaboration with a candidate doctoral student research proposal of a maximum of 5 pages, containing at least the following items: title of the project, an acronym, situating the research, the research objectives, the research strategy and a work plan made up of work packages, deliverables and milestones. Work packages clearly include defined tasks.
  • The proposal is submitted via e-mail: Foundation-at-vub.be
  • The applications are screened for admissibility (completeness and admission criteria).
  • The selection is based on two admission criteria: project and application possibilities.
  • The steering committee of the VUB AVN Fund decides on the approval of the research project and the renewal of the doctoral scholarship.
